0 reports about 8184448661The number was first reported 31st Jul, 2025
Received a phone call from 8184448661? Report here
File a report about 8184448661 |
Phone Number Variations: 8184448661, 08184-448661, 918184448661, 008184448661, 1918184448661, +1918184448661